HCBS Overview
Home and Community-Based Services (HCBS) are Medicaid-funded programs that provide long-term care and support to individuals in their homes or community settings, rather than in institutional facilities like nursing homes.

HCBS Compliance Assessment
New York State Adult Care Facilities that have one or more residents receiving Medicaid-funded Home and Community-Based Services are required to comply with the Final Rule. This assessment is a crucial component of the New York State remediation plan and can also help facilities evaluate their compliance with newly implemented adult care facility regulations.

Person-Centered Planning
The New York State Department of Health hosted a “Person-Centered Planning – Lessons from the Field” webinar April 8, 2019 featuring three Home and Community-Based Service provider exemplars in person-centered care delivery. The providers shared how they use best and promising practices within an Adult Care Facility, Adult Day Health Care Center, and Social Adult Day Program.
